🎓 Understanding Senior Professor Jobs in Educational Management

A Senior Professor in Educational Management represents the pinnacle of academic achievement in this dynamic field. This position, often synonymous with full professorship or chair roles, involves not just expert teaching but also shaping the future of educational institutions through research and leadership. Educational Management, meaning the strategic oversight of schools, universities, and training programs—including policy development, resource allocation, and performance evaluation—demands profound expertise from its senior leaders.

Roles and Responsibilities

Senior Professors in Educational Management oversee departments, mentor junior faculty, and lead interdisciplinary projects. They teach graduate-level courses on topics like organizational behavior in education and conduct research influencing national policies. Daily tasks include reviewing manuscripts for journals, securing multimillion-dollar grants from bodies like the National Science Foundation, and consulting for governments on equity initiatives.

Historically, this role evolved from 19th-century university chairs to modern leaders addressing globalization and technology integration in education since the 1990s.

Required Academic Qualifications, Research Focus, Experience, and Skills

To qualify for Senior Professor jobs in Educational Management, candidates need a PhD in Educational Leadership, Administration, or a closely related discipline. Research focus typically centers on leadership theories (e.g., transformational leadership), school improvement strategies, and analytics for educational outcomes.

Preferred experience includes 15+ years in academia, tenure promotion, 50+ publications in top-tier journals, and leading funded projects worth over $1 million. Key skills and competencies encompass:

  • Strategic planning and policy analysis
  • Grant proposal writing and fundraising
  • Mentoring PhD students to completion
  • Data interpretation using tools like qualitative coding software
  • Cross-cultural leadership, vital in diverse settings like those in Australia or the UK

Definitions

Educational Management: The process of planning, organizing, directing, and controlling educational resources to achieve institutional goals efficiently.

Tenure: Permanent academic employment granted after rigorous review, protecting scholarly freedom.

H-index: A metric measuring productivity and citation impact, e.g., an h-index of 40 means 40 papers cited at least 40 times each.

Career Path and Actionable Advice

Aspiring Senior Professors start as lecturers or research assistants, advancing through assistant to associate professor stages over 10-20 years. Frequently Asked Questions

🎓What is a Senior Professor in Educational Management?

A Senior Professor in Educational Management is a top-tier academic leader who combines advanced teaching, research, and administrative expertise in managing educational institutions and policies. They guide departments and contribute to strategic planning. For more on general roles, see professor jobs.

📋What are the key responsibilities of a Senior Professor?

Key duties include leading research projects, supervising graduate students, publishing in journals like the Journal of Educational Administration, teaching advanced courses, and advising on institutional policies. They often secure grants exceeding $500,000 annually.

📚What qualifications are needed for Senior Professor jobs in Educational Management?

Typically, a PhD in Education, Educational Leadership, or a related field is required, along with 10-15 years of academic experience, including tenure as an Associate Professor.

🔬What research focus is expected in Educational Management?

Focus areas include school leadership models, policy analysis, curriculum innovation, and equity in education. Senior Professors publish on topics like sustainable educational reforms, often citing data from OECD reports.

💼What skills are essential for these roles?

Leadership, strategic planning, data analysis, grant writing, and interpersonal skills for mentoring. Proficiency in tools like SPSS for educational data is common.

🚀How does one advance to Senior Professor?

Start as a Lecturer, progress to Associate Professor via tenure-track, build a strong publication record (50+ papers), and lead departments. Check academic CV tips for success.

💰What is the salary range for Senior Professors in Educational Management?

Globally, salaries range from $120,000-$250,000 USD annually, higher in the US or Australia. In the UK, it's around £80,000-£120,000, varying by institution prestige.

🌍Why specialize in Educational Management as a Senior Professor?

This field addresses critical issues like improving school outcomes and policy reforms, offering impact on global education systems amid challenges like digital transformation.

⚠️What challenges do Senior Professors face?

Balancing research, teaching, and administration; securing funding in competitive environments; adapting to policy changes like those in higher education accountability frameworks.
